This was a originally a corn crib. It has been tagged, carefully dismantled, and put in storage, waiting for your next custom build.
Features:
- 8′-9″ floor to top of eave beam 7×7 Posts and Main Cross Ties
- 5×5 girts
- 8/12 Roof Pitch
- Hand Hewn Timbers
This frame is built of 7×7 hand hewn red oak timbers, except for the eave beams, which are sycamore. The cross ties are red oak and poplar. The braces are red oak. The roof pitch is 8/12. It is 8′-9″ to the eaves. There are a total of 4 bents. This frame could be used to make a quaint little cabin, or as part of a larger project. The posts also could be set on piers to gain head room.
